Description:
|
Large organization looking for a VP of Communications. As a Vice President (with a focus on change management, education and communication) in the Benefits Consulting group, the incumbent will help clients set strategy, direct and conduct research and manage the implementation of final approach for custom communication campaigns and projects. Main duties will include: Assists and sometimes lead sales effort. Works with clients to understand business strategy/project goals based on existing documentation and/or research. Develop communication strategies/program approaches to address objectives and drive behavior change including conducting employee research (focus groups/surveys, etc.). Manages project implementation including providing work direction to internal production managers, writers and designers, as appropriate. Coordinates work with other benefit consultants and project teams on integrated delivery projects. Writing and editing of client deliverables to confirm that key messages track to objectives and behavior change objective. Ideal candidate will have a BS in Communication- or Business-related field with 1-3 years of experience in communication support work. Excellent organizational skills and the ability to multi-task. Strong desktop application skills (Microsoft Word, PowerPoint, Excel); familiarity with Microsoft Project and standard design programs a plus. 8-10 years supporting internal communication, preferably in a consulting environment with HR/benefits content. Experience developing communication strategies based on organizational change and individual behavior change theories. Excellent writer with superior client management/project management skills. Deep content knowledge on both retirement (DB and 401(k)) and health care plan design.
